New York - Session 2025-2026
Title: Establishes the crime of misappropriation of payroll funds
Establishes the crime of misappropriation of payroll funds when a person knows that funds are designated for use as employee payroll funds or as payment of payroll taxes, and intentionally prevents the funds from being used for their designated purpose.
